About Weber State Wildcats Women's Basketball
As of the current season, the Weber State Wildcats women's basketball team is actively participating in the Big Sky Conference, showcasing promising talent and competitiveness. Their recent performance has seen a blend of veteran players and talented newcomers, contributing to an exciting dynamic on the court. The Wildcats play their home games at the Dee Events Center in Ogden, Utah, where they have built a loyal fan base. Weber State Wildcats Women's Basketball History
The Weber State Wildcats women's basketball program was established in 1974, making it one of the longest-standing women's collegiate basketball teams in the state of Utah. Initially, the team competed in the AIAW (Association for Intercollegiate Athletics for Women) before transitioning to the NCAA in 1982. The Wildcats quickly made a name for themselves in the Big Sky Conference, showcasing their talent and determination on the court. Over the years, they have seen growth in both talent and competition, appearing in various national tournaments and making strides in developing their athletes both on and off the court. Some notable figures in their history include former coach Jed Judkins, who led the team to several successful seasons, and standout players who have left their mark in the program's legacy. The Wildcats have consistently focused on building a strong team culture, emphasizing hard work, discipline, and community engagement, all of which have contributed to their lasting impact in collegiate women's basketball.
